On Saturday, I ran a 5k. I found out about it before we even moved here and have been training for it. I was a bit nervous because my leg had been hurting me but I took some ibuprofen beforehand and it didn't bother me too much. The race was up in Volcano Village (which is near the volcano national park) and the weather was perfect. Sunny and cool but warm enough once you got going. Poor Jason and Anna were quite cold. There were a lot of trees so they kept things nicely shaded.
I hadn't done a race in a LONG time and I was a little surprised at how nervous/concerned I was. I worried about my leg, being too cold (I'm used to hot now but not cold), the altitude (it was at 4000 ft) and had very low expectations for my time. I needn't have worried, I was a rock star! Once I got going my leg slightly twinged but not enough to slow me down. It was warm enough that the shade felt good. I didn't notice the altitude and I came in in 25:44 which averages 8:18 per mile! I even passed someone near the end that I had been running with for the last half. It was so great that I'm already planning what I'm going to do next time.
